Political factors

Icon

Government Regulations and Policies

Government regulations and policies are critical for Razor Energy. Environmental regulations, carbon pricing, and incentives for green energy projects affect investments and profitability. In 2024, the Canadian government increased carbon pricing, impacting operational costs. Incentives for renewable energy projects could offer new opportunities. These factors require careful monitoring and strategic adaptation by Razor Energy.

Icon

Political Stability and Geopolitical Factors

Political stability is vital for Razor Energy's operations. Geopolitical events significantly impact energy markets. For example, the Russia-Ukraine conflict caused a 30% increase in European natural gas prices in 2022. International relations affect supply chains and investment, introducing uncertainty. Indigenous Rights and Consultations

Razor Energy's operations are subject to Indigenous rights considerations, potentially impacting project timelines and approvals. Meaningful consultation with Indigenous communities is crucial for obtaining social license and mitigating risks. Delays or opposition from Indigenous groups can lead to project setbacks and increased costs. According to a 2024 report, 70% of resource projects face delays due to consultation issues.

  • Consultation costs can increase project expenses by 10-20%.
  • Successful engagement improves project outcomes.
  • Legal frameworks mandate consultation in Canada.

Advancements in Oil and Gas Extraction Technology

Technological progress in oil and gas is crucial. Enhanced Oil Recovery (EOR) methods, like CO2 injection, boost output. Razor Energy can leverage these to maximize returns. In 2024, EOR projects saw a 10% increase in production, showing strong potential.

Icon

Development of Green Energy Technologies

The evolution of green energy technologies significantly impacts Razor Energy's diversification efforts. Advanced geothermal systems, CCUS, and hydrogen production are key areas. In 2024, the global CCUS capacity reached 50 million tons, a 20% increase. Investment in green hydrogen projects is projected to hit $10 billion by 2025.

Insolvency and Restructuring Laws

Insolvency and restructuring laws, including the CCAA and BIA, are critical for Razor Energy. These laws directly impact the company's ability to manage financial distress and navigate sales. Recent proceedings under these acts likely shaped Razor's strategic decisions. Understanding these legal frameworks is crucial for stakeholders.

  • CCAA filings in Canada increased by 15% in 2024.
  • The BIA governs bankruptcy processes.
  • Restructuring can affect asset values.
  • Legal costs are a factor during insolvency.

Geothermal Resource Availability

For FutEra Power's geothermal ventures, the accessibility and long-term viability of geothermal resources are critical environmental considerations. These resources directly affect the effectiveness and financial viability of clean energy generation. Analyzing geothermal gradients, subsurface temperatures, and the capacity for sustainable extraction is crucial for project planning. For example, the global geothermal market is projected to reach $62.7 billion by 2025.

  • Geothermal energy capacity additions expected to grow by 18% by the end of 2024.
  • The average capacity factor for geothermal plants is around 74%.
  • The United States leads in geothermal power capacity with 3.7 GW in 2024.
  • Geothermal energy has a low carbon footprint, emitting approximately 45 g of CO2 equivalent per kWh.
